Output 3f96918b60a13d77b9dd663e9c6d5b181d66f116c243ad4be5b098d0255e4d25:0

value
743361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76afee15b76a1ff0f4c261defdbf10a921b1042e OP_EQUAL
address
3CWaR1dngkekx5pFjsFdcc9DJGqPiNvEAS
transaction
3f96918b60a13d77b9dd663e9c6d5b181d66f116c243ad4be5b098d0255e4d25
confirmations
304463
spent
true